What Are AI Agents?

AI agents are software-based systems capable of making decisions, learning from data, and performing tasks that traditionally require human intervention. Unlike simple automation tools, AI agents use advanced machine learning algorithms and natural language processing (NLP) to interact with customers, field technicians, and business systems dynamically.

The Potential Uses of AI Agents in Field Service

AI agents can revolutionize several aspects of the field service industry. Below are some of the most impactful ways AI can be leveraged:

1. Intelligent Scheduling & Dispatching

One of the biggest challenges for field service businesses is managing technician schedules efficiently. AI agents can:

  • Analyze job urgency, technician skills, location, and availability in real time to assign the best technician for each task.
  • Optimize travel routes to reduce fuel costs and improve response times.
  • Automatically reschedule jobs when unforeseen delays occur, keeping customers informed in the process.

By eliminating manual scheduling bottlenecks, AI agents can significantly improve resource allocation and minimize wasted time.


2. Predictive Maintenance

AI-powered predictive maintenance can help businesses transition from reactive to proactive service models. AI agents can:

  • Analyze sensor data from field equipment to detect anomalies and predict when a failure is likely to occur.
  • Automatically schedule maintenance before an issue leads to downtime, reducing emergency callouts.
  • Provide real-time diagnostic support to field technicians, ensuring they arrive at the job site fully prepared.

By preventing failures before they happen, AI agents help businesses avoid costly repairs and extend the lifespan of assets.


3. Enhanced Customer Communication

Customers today expect real-time updates and seamless interactions. AI-driven virtual assistants can:

  • Handle customer inquiries 24/7, reducing response times and increasing satisfaction.
  • Send automated appointment reminders and updates about technician arrival times.
  • Gather post-service feedback to help businesses improve their offerings.

By improving communication touchpoints, AI agents can enhance customer trust and engagement.


4. AI-Powered Diagnostics & Troubleshooting

Field technicians often need to diagnose and resolve issues quickly. AI-driven diagnostic systems can:

  • Guide technicians step by step through troubleshooting processes based on past service data.
  • Provide augmented reality (AR) support, overlaying real-time instructions on physical equipment.
  • Analyze repair trends to recommend the most effective fixes for recurring problems.

By reducing troubleshooting time, AI agents can improve first-time fix rates and enhance technician productivity.


5. Automated Reporting & Compliance

Field service businesses often deal with complex compliance requirements. AI agents can:

  • Automatically generate service reports and log job details.
  • Ensure compliance with industry regulations by tracking safety procedures.
  • Identify operational inefficiencies and suggest process improvements based on data analysis.

With AI handling administrative tasks, field service teams can focus more on delivering excellent service.

Challenges & Considerations

Despite their potential, AI agents also come with challenges that businesses must navigate:

  • Implementation Costs: Upfront investment in AI technology can be significant, though long-term benefits often outweigh costs.
  • Integration Complexity: AI must seamlessly integrate with existing software, such as CRM, ERP, and field service management platforms.
  • Workforce Adaptation: Employees need proper training to work alongside AI agents effectively and leverage their capabilities.
  • Data Privacy & Security: AI systems handle vast amounts of customer and operational data, requiring stringent security measures.

Businesses must take a strategic approach to AI adoption, ensuring that technology enhances human productivity rather than replacing valuable field service expertise.
